Credit Card Statement Tips

Getting more from your extracted statement data.

  • 1

    Compare across cards

    Export statements from multiple cards, merge the sheets, and track total spending across all your credit lines.

  • 2

    Use clear photos

    Lay printed statements flat and photograph in good lighting. Avoid shadows and keep all edges in frame.

  • 3

    Check fees monthly

    Interest charges and fees sometimes change without notice. A monthly export makes it easy to catch increases.

  • 4

    Upload full PDFs

    Multi-page statements are processed as one document. No need to split pages — the AI handles continuation tables.

  • 5

    Keep file names organized

    Name downloaded files by card and month (e.g. amex-2026-03.xlsx) so they are easy to find later.

  • 6

    Share with your accountant

    Export to CSV or Excel and send directly. Structured columns save time during tax prep and expense reviews.

Review Charges and Prepare Disputes

With your transactions in a spreadsheet, spotting errors and building a dispute case is straightforward.

What to look for

  • Unfamiliar merchant names (some use parent company names)
  • Small test charges followed by larger ones
  • Duplicate charges for the same amount and date
  • Recurring subscriptions you thought were canceled
  • Foreign transaction fees on domestic purchases

Dispute-ready in minutes

Sort by amount to identify overcharges. Filter by date to isolate a billing cycle. Copy transaction rows directly into your dispute letter or email. Credit card issuers need the exact date, amount, and merchant name — your spreadsheet provides all three.

Export 12 months of statements and sort by merchant to run an annual subscription audit.
